A Singapore court sentenced Nguyen Ngoc Giau to life in prison for fatally stabbing her boyfriend in a jealous rage in 2021.
A 43-year-old Vietnamese woman, Nguyen Ngoc Giau, was sentenced to life imprisonment on October 7, 2025, for fatally stabbing her boyfriend, 51-year-old Cho Wang Keung, in a Singapore public housing corridor on July 15, 2021.
The attack followed a dispute over his interactions with a female beer promoter, fueling Giau’s jealousy.
The court found she acted with intent, rejecting claims of intoxication and sudden provocation.
Giau, a Singapore permanent resident, had lived with the victim since 2020 and had a history of volatile arguments.
She is appealing the verdict.
